That is why the eyes of a girl drawn in anime style, as well as when depicting traditional portraits, are best drawn in several stages. So, let's start drawing eyes in anime style. First, we need to draw a fairly simple diagram. To do this, we need to draw four lines (you can use a ruler), two of which will be parallel, and two - perpendicular. It is inside the resulting contours that we will draw the eyes.At the next stage of work we need eyesslightly stretched upwards. This is a characteristic feature of the facial detail of all characters drawn in anime technique. We need to depict two ovals of the same size. Their upper part should be slightly flattened, and the ovals themselves should be slightly tilted as you can see in the picture. If you have certain drawing skills and an accurate eye, you can draw the ovals right away, without making preliminary markings, but, as practice shows, with markings there is a better chance of doing everything without mistakes. In this case, they will be symmetrically located, and their shape and size will be absolutely identical.
The third stage of drawing is the removalmarking lines from the drawing and adding the following mandatory strokes - eyelash contours. After this, you need to put the pencil aside and carefully examine the resulting image. If you notice any inaccuracies or errors, correct them now, otherwise it will be extremely difficult to do this at subsequent stages.
Step 4 of Drawing Anime Eyescan be considered the most difficult and responsible. Right now we need to give them a characteristic look. By and large, it is necessary to simply draw the pupils correctly. But, there is a small nuance - the eyes of anime girls must necessarily sparkle, sparkle. This effect can be achieved by correctly distributing the light and shadow, that is, different parts of the eyes, previously highlighted by contours, should look different. During coloring, we will in no case paint the entire pupil in the same color. With the help of shading and small additional lines. We will make different highlights (colored). Thus, we will get bright, piercing, pronounced sparkling eyes.
There remains the final stage, when weit is necessary to finally paint the eyes in the required color, and the iris can remain black or you can use any other shade. Also, you need to outline the contours of the face, add such elements as the mouth, nose, eyebrows, hair.
